    Info below taken from the Match Day thread and kindly posted by ‘Upthemaggies’:

    This season
    Wootton 12, Roberts 8, Rodrigues 8, Cameron 4, Vincent 3, Lacey 2, O'Brien 1, Mitchell 1, Richardson 1

    Last season
    Wootton 17, Rodrigues 12, Boldewijn 7, Knowles 6, Ellis 6, Reeves 5, Sam 3, O'Brien 3, Doyle 2, Effiong 1,
    Barnett 1, Kelly-Evans 1, Roberts 1, Chicksen 1, Own Goal 1
